Output d30c3e8c564e96e3e23e5cb7a7160b51cf0af0545c95fd2532d6f806f0da9498:0

value
339104697
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c8a694ada4f5658d0d8d7aa67203c81eca87caca OP_EQUALVERIFY OP_CHECKSIG
address
1KHwhbsUvvrzkyUj7LooNWPuZopxzWH4T4
transaction
d30c3e8c564e96e3e23e5cb7a7160b51cf0af0545c95fd2532d6f806f0da9498
confirmations
550224
spent
true